About the Solidigm S4520 480GB SATA 6Gbps 2.5" Enterprise SSD

At 0.6 W idle power consumption, the Solidigm S4520 480GB delivers exceptional efficiency per terabyte for dense all-flash array deployments where power density directly impacts operational costs. Built on Solidigm's Intel 3D NAND TLC architecture, this 2.5-inch enterprise SSD combines reliable performance with the durability demanded by mission-critical infrastructure. With sequential read speeds up to 550 MB/s and random read performance reaching 97,000 IOPS, the S4520 addresses the throughput and latency requirements of high-capacity storage environments without excessive power draw during sustained operations.

The S4520 is particularly well-suited for read-intensive workloads such as database hosting, virtual machine storage, and content delivery platforms where consistent latency and drive endurance are essential. Its compact 2.5-inch form factor and SATA 6Gbps interface ensure broad compatibility across leading server and storage platforms from Dell, HPE, Lenovo, and Supermicro. Enterprise IT teams operating large-scale infrastructure benefit from its predictable performance profile and low thermal output across high-density rack configurations.

Technical Specifications

BrandSolidigm
CategoryEnterprise SSDs
SKUSSDSC2KB480GZ1Z
Part NumberSSDSC2KB480GZ1Z
ConditionNew
Capacity480 GB
Form Factor2.5"
InterfaceSATA III 6Gbps
Manufacturer Part NumberSSDSC2KB480GZ1Z
Capacity480 GB
Form Factor2.5-inch
Height7 mm
InterfaceSATA 6Gbps (SATA III)
NAND TechnologyIntel 3D NAND TLC
Sequential ReadUp to 550 MB/s
Sequential WriteUp to 280 MB/s
Random Read (4K)Up to 97,000 IOPS
Random Write (4K)Up to 32,000 IOPS
Endurance Rating1 DWPD (Drive Writes Per Day over 5 years)
Total Bytes Written (TBW)876 TBW
Mean Time Between Failures (MTBF)2,000,000 hours
Power Loss Data ProtectionYes (capacitor-based)
Hardware EncryptionAES 256-bit
Active Power (Read)2.8 W (typical)
Idle Power0.6 W (typical)
Operating Temperature0°C to 70°C
Non-Operating Temperature-55°C to 95°C
Dimensions100.45 mm x 69.85 mm x 7 mm
